Background

The U.S. Postal Service’s mission is to provide timely, reliable, secure, and affordable mail and package delivery to more than 160 million residential and business addresses across the country. The U.S. Postal Service Office of Inspector General reviews delivery operations at facilities across the country and provides management with timely feedback in furtherance of this mission. 

This interim report presents the results of our self-initiated audit of delivery operations and property conditions at the New Rochelle Main Post Office in New Rochelle, NY. The New Rochelle MPO is in the New York 3 District of the Atlantic Area and serves about 61,342 people in ZIP Codes 10801 and 10805, which are considered urban areas. The unit also services ZIP Code 10802 used for PO Box routes.
